About Nagarur

Nagarur is known for its historical significance and cultural heritage. The town is home to several ancient temples, which are an important part of the local culture and traditions. These temples are not only religious sites but also architectural marvels, attracting devotees and history enthusiasts alike.

One of the most famous temples in Nagarur is the Sri Konetiraya Swamy Temple. Dedicated to Lord Vishnu, this temple is believed to have been built during the Vijayanagara Empire in the 16th century. The intricate carvings and sculptures on the temple walls depict scenes from Hindu mythology, making it a must-visit for art lovers.

Another prominent temple in Nagarur is the Sri Raghavendra Swamy Mutt. This mutt is a religious and spiritual center for the followers of Sri Raghavendra Swamy, a renowned saint in the Hindu religion. The mutt holds regular religious ceremonies and attracts devotees from far and wide.

Apart from the temples, Nagarur also boasts of natural beauty. The town is located amidst lush greenery, and there are several scenic spots nearby that offer breathtaking views. One such place is the Penukonda Fort, situated just a short drive away from Nagarur. This fort is known for its architectural brilliance and historical significance. It was once the capital of the Vijayanagara Empire and has witnessed many historical events over the centuries.

Another must-visit place near Nagarur is the Penna Ahobilam. Located on the banks of the Penna River, this site is believed to be the place where Lord Narasimha appeared to protect his devotee Prahlada. The beautiful surroundings and tranquil atmosphere make it a popular spot for picnics and family outings.

To reach Nagarur, one can opt for various modes of transportation. The nearest airport to Nagarur is the Kempegowda International Airport in Bangalore, which is approximately 160 kilometers away. From the airport, one can hire a taxi or take a bus to reach Nagarur.

For those traveling by train, the nearest railway station is the Anantapur Railway Station, which is about 25 kilometers away from Nagarur. From the railway station, one can hire a cab or take a local bus to reach Nagarur.

If you prefer to travel by road, Nagarur can be easily accessed through the extensive network of roads in the region. Several state highways connect Nagarur to major cities and towns in Andhra Pradesh and neighboring states. Private taxis and buses are available for hire from nearby cities like Anantapur, Bangalore, and Hyderabad.
